Seamonkey 2.53.1 on -current: preferences not honored

After the latest update, I notice two user settings that are mis-behaving. One of them is clearing browser history (and other private data) when exiting Seamonkey.
I did *ahem* interrupt the "checking for plugin compatibility" message during the first launch after update, b/c I was trying to look up something for a family member on the phone, so that may have borked the settings temporarily.
However, even after going into Edit/Preferences, un-checking and re-checking every desired box under Privacy & Security/Private Data, including Browsing History, I'm still getting links showing as "visited" immediately after launch. The browsing history is not being cleared at exit.
How would I go about fixing this, without wiping all my preferences?
Is anyone else encountering this behavior?
